In order for DNS queries for a domain to reach Azure DNS, the … WebFeb 19, 2024 · Create a reusable delegation set. We will start by creating a delegation set that we can reuse for all the domain name you want to use the nameservers for. In this example, we will use NS.001 as the caller reference. aws route53 create-reusable-delegation-set --caller-reference NS.001.
